Transaction 86d036e030a45f5b86aae9fcce4d3e148e5dae358757016a7fcfb2841aa47779
1 Input
1 Output
-
86d036e030a45f5b86aae9fcce4d3e148e5dae358757016a7fcfb2841aa47779:0
- value
- 89599445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d6af480584278e842922154830c79b68b71730 OP_EQUAL
- address
- MEpA6NViuYs8DeiG6BFeWACqp22uU1vMVr